Introduction

Vincent van Gogh's Le Moulin de la Galette, painted in 1886, is a captivating piece of art that showcases the artist's unique style and mastery over oil paints. This article delves into the historical context, composition, and significance of this iconic painting.

Historical Context

In 1886, van Gogh moved to Paris to live with his brother Theo and immerse himself in the thriving art scene. During this time, he was exposed to various artistic movements such as Impressionism, Symbolism, Pointillism, and Japanese art. These influences are evident in Le Moulin de la Galette, which features lighter colors and a more vibrant atmosphere compared to his earlier works.

Composition

  • Three paintings with similar compositions: Van Gogh painted three versions of Le Moulin de la Galette, each with a slightly different composition. The version in question, F348a JH1221, measures 46 cm x 38 cm and is housed at the Museo Nacional de Bellas Artes in Buenos Aires.
  • Other paintings titled Le Moulin de la Galette: Besides these three versions, van Gogh created other paintings with the same title. These works depict various aspects of Montmartre and its iconic windmill, capturing the essence of Parisian life during that era.

Significance

Le Moulin de la Galette is a testament to van Gogh's growth as an artist and his ability to adapt to new artistic movements. The painting reflects the vibrant atmosphere of Montmartre, with its lively dance halls and picturesque windmills. By incorporating Impressionist elements into his work, van Gogh created a piece that resonates with viewers even today.
